/**
45
 * Field names in CairoSurface.java
46
 */
47
#define SURFACE "surfacePointer"
48
#define SHARED "sharedBuffer"
49
 
50
/* prototypes */
51
static void setNativeObject( JNIEnv *env, jobject obj, void *ptr, const char *pointer );
52
 
53
/**
54
 * Creates a cairo surface, ARGB32, native ordering, premultiplied alpha.
55
 */
56
JNIEXPORT void JNICALL
57
Java_gnu_java_awt_peer_gtk_CairoSurface_create
58
(JNIEnv *env, jobject obj, jint width, jint height, jint stride,
59
 jintArray buf )
60
{
61
  cairo_surface_t* surface;
62
  jboolean isCopy;
63
 
64
  /* Retrieve java-created data array */
65
  void *data = (*env)->GetIntArrayElements (env, buf, &isCopy);
66
 
67
  /* Set sharedBuffer variable */
68
  jclass cls = (*env)->GetObjectClass (env, obj);
69
  jfieldID field = (*env)->GetFieldID (env, cls, SHARED, "Z");
70
  g_assert (field != 0);
71
 
72
  if (isCopy == JNI_TRUE)
73
    {
74
      (*env)->SetBooleanField (env, obj, field, JNI_FALSE);
75
      void* temp = g_malloc(stride * height * 4);
76
      memcpy(temp, data, stride * height * 4);
77
      (*env)->ReleaseIntArrayElements (env, buf, data, 0);
78
      data = temp;
79
    }
80
  else
81
    (*env)->SetBooleanField (env, obj, field, JNI_TRUE);
82
 
83
  /* Create the cairo surface and set the java pointer */
84
  surface = cairo_image_surface_create_for_data
85
    (data, CAIRO_FORMAT_ARGB32, width, height, stride * 4);
86
 
87
  setNativeObject(env, obj, surface, SURFACE);
88
}

JNIEXPORT jlong JNICALL
181
Java_gnu_java_awt_peer_gtk_CairoSurface_getFlippedBuffer
182
(JNIEnv *env __attribute__((unused)), jobject obj __attribute__((unused)),
183
 jlong surfacePointer)
184
{
185
  cairo_surface_t* surface;
186
  jint *src;
187
  jint *dst;
188
  int i, t, width, height;
189
  jclass cls;
190
  jfieldID field;
191
 
192
  /* Retrieve pointer to cairo data buffer */
193
  surface = JLONG_TO_PTR(void, surfacePointer);
194
  src = (jint*)cairo_image_surface_get_data(surface);
195
 
196
  /* Retrieve dimensions of surface, from java fields */
197
  cls = (*env)->GetObjectClass (env, obj);
198
  field = (*env)->GetFieldID (env, cls, "width", "I");
199
  g_assert (field != 0);
200
  width = (*env)->GetIntField (env, obj, field);
201
 
202
  field = (*env)->GetFieldID (env, cls, "height", "I");
203
  g_assert (field != 0);
204
  height = (*env)->GetIntField (env, obj, field);
205
 
206
  /* Create destination array */
207
  g_assert( src != NULL );
208
  dst = g_malloc( width * height * sizeof( jint ) );
209
 
210
  /* Copy data into destination array, reversing sample order of each pixel */
211
  for(i = 0; i < (height * width); i++ )
212
    {
213
      t = (src[i] & 0x0000FF) << 16;
214
      dst[i] = (src[i] & 0x00FF0000) >> 16;
215
      dst[i] |= (src[i] & 0xFF00FF00);
216
      dst[i] |= t;
217
    }
218
 
219
  return PTR_TO_JLONG(dst);
220
}

/**
240
 * copyArea.
241
 */
242
JNIEXPORT void JNICALL
243
Java_gnu_java_awt_peer_gtk_CairoSurface_copyAreaNative2
244
(JNIEnv *env __attribute__((unused)), jobject obj __attribute__((unused)),
245
 jlong surfacePointer,
246
 jint x, jint y, jint w, jint h, jint dx, jint dy, jint stride)
247
{
248
  int row;
249
  int srcOffset, dstOffset;
250
  jint *temp;
251
 
252
  /* Retrieve pointer to cairo data buffer */
253
  cairo_surface_t* surface = JLONG_TO_PTR(void, surfacePointer);
254
  jint *pixeldata = (jint*)cairo_image_surface_get_data(surface);
255
  g_assert( pixeldata != NULL );
256
 
257
  /* Create temporary buffer and calculate offsets */
258
  temp = g_malloc( h * w * 4 );
259
  g_assert( temp != NULL );
260
 
261
  srcOffset = x + (y * stride);
262
  dstOffset = (x + dx) + ((y + dy) * stride);
263
 
264
  /* Copy desired region into temporary buffer */
265
  for( row = 0; row < h; row++ )
266
    memcpy( temp + (w * row), pixeldata + srcOffset + (stride * row), w * 4 );
267
 
268
  /* Copy out of buffer and to destination */
269
  for( row = 0; row < h; row++ )
270
    memcpy( pixeldata + dstOffset + (stride * row), temp + (w * row), w * 4 );
271
 
272
  g_free( temp );
273
}
